root@pts/4 # touch 1

touch: cannot touch `1': Read-only file system

mount没有权限?

root@pts/0 # mount

/dev/sda2 on / type ext4 (rw)

proc on /proc type proc (rw)

sysfs on /sys type sysfs (rw)

devpts on /dev/pts type devpts (rw,gid=5,mode=620)

tmpfs on /dev/shm type tmpfs (rw,rootcontext="system_u:object_r:tmpfs_t:s0")

/dev/sda1 on /boot type ext4 (rw)

none on /proc/sys/fs/binfmt_misc type binfmt_misc (rw)

sunrpc on /var/lib/nfs/rpc_pipefs type rpc_pipefs (rw)

192.168.0.71:/vol/vol2 on /share type nfs (rw,addr=192.168.0.71)

/dev/sdb1 on /backup type xfs (rw)

nfsd on /proc/fs/nfsd type nfsd (rw)

192.168.3.150:/tmp/sem on /tmp/sem type nfs (rw,vers=4,addr=192.168.3.150,clientaddr=192.168.2.127)

是rw权限。什么情况?

看下权限,755,没有问题啊

root@pts/4 # ll

total 16

drwxr-xr-x 4 root root 4096 Dec  3 11:30 client

drwxr-xr-x 2 root root 4096 Dec 25 15:17 flash

drwxr-xr-x 6 root root 4096 Dec  3 16:46 touch

drwxr-xr-x 7 root root 4096 Dec  3 15:47 web赋值777权限试试?

root@pts/4 # chmod -R 777 /tmp/sem/

chmod: changing permissions of `/tmp/sem/client': Read-only file system

chmod: changing permissions of `/tmp/sem/flash': Read-only file system

chmod: changing permissions of `/tmp/sem/web/model2': Read-only file system

服务器的文件系统损坏了?验证下

root@pts/1 # mkdir 1

192.168.3.150 [/tmp/sem] 2014-12-26 12:08:18

root@pts/1 # ls

1  client  flash  touch  web

服务器端没有问题啊。

难道是nfs问题吗?

root@pts/1 # vim /etc/exports

/tmp/htdocs/sem * (rw)

没有看出来,重启下nfs试试?

192.168.3.150 [/www/youyuan.com.1/htdocs/sem] 2014-12-26 12:49:59

root@pts/1 # /etc/init.d/nfs restart

Shutting down NFS daemon:                                  [  OK  ]

Shutting down NFS mountd:                                  [  OK  ]

Shutting down NFS quotas:                                  [  OK  ]

Shutting down NFS services:                                [  OK  ]

Starting NFS services:  exportfs: No options for /www/youyuan.com.1/htdocs/sem *: suggest *(sync) to avoid warning

exportfs: No host name given with /www/youyuan.com.1/htdocs/sem (rw), suggest *(rw) to avoid warning

exportfs: incompatible duplicated export entries:

exportfs:       *:/www/youyuan.com.1/htdocs/sem (0x424) [IGNORED]

exportfs:       *:/www/youyuan.com.1/htdocs/sem (0x425)

[  OK  ]

Starting NFS quotas:                                       [  OK  ]

Starting NFS mountd:                                       [  OK  ]

Starting NFS daemon:                                       [  OK  ]

报配置文件有误,*和(rw)之间不能有空格。

修正下吧,“*”范围太大了

root@pts/1 # vim /etc/exports

/tmp/htdocs/sem 192.168.0.0/22(rw,sync,no_root_squash)

重启nfs:

root@pts/1 # /etc/init.d/nfs restart

Shutting down NFS daemon:                                  [  OK  ]

Shutting down NFS mountd:                                  [  OK  ]

Shutting down NFS quotas:                                  [  OK  ]

Shutting down NFS services:                                [  OK  ]

Starting NFS services:                                     [  OK  ]

Starting NFS quotas:                                       [  OK  ]

Starting NFS mountd:                                       [  OK  ]

Starting NFS daemon:                                       [  OK  ]

客户端在试一下?

root@pts/4 # touch 1

touch: cannot touch `1': Permission denied

这次报访问拒绝,这个是与权限相关的,再次赋值777试试?

root@pts/4 # touch 1

192.168.0.193 [/tmp/sem] 2014-12-26 13:01:47

root@pts/4 # ls

1  client  flash  touch  web

root@pts/4 # rm 1

可以了,修正权限为755

root@pts/4 # touch 1

192.168.0.193 [/tmp/sem] 2014-12-26 13:02:14

root@pts/4 # ls

1  client  flash  touch  web

问题解决;

linux nfs 修复文件,linux nfs Read-only file system相关推荐

  1. linux执行sh提示非标准环境,Linux执行.sh文件时提示No such file or directory该怎么办(三种解决办法)...

    先给大家看下问题描述,下图是我在运行时出现错误截图: 解决方法 分析原因,可能因为我平台迁移碰到权限问题我们来进行权限转换 1)在Windows下转换: 利用一些编辑器如UltraEdit或EditP ...

  2. linux的头文件下载,Linux内核头文件(linux headers)

    更新 Linux 内核头文件(linux headers) 三 8th, 2013 2,474 views | 发表评论 | Trackback 一般来说,如果不是自己编译 kernel,那么更新头文 ...

  3. Linux执行.sh文件,提示No such file or directory的问题的解决方法

    Linux执行.sh文件,提示No such file or directory的问题的解决方法 在window平台下,写好shell脚本文件,迁移到linux平台,赋过可执行权限,执行该sh文件, ...

  4. linux的服务文件,Linux的nfs文件服务

    一.NFS概念(适用于Linux与Linux的网络文件系统) 二.安装nfs启动服务 yum install nfs-utils systemctl enbale nfs-server systemc ...

  5. linux如何自动处理文件,linux文件处理

    df: 可以进看当前的系统disk space usage fdisk:可以用来查看,管理disk /etc/fstab: 可以查看硬盘的mount信息; 如果修改了这个文件的内容,可以通过 sudo ...

  6. windows和linux添加引导文件,Linux与Windows 10用grub引导教程-Go语言中文社区

    前言 去年暑假的时候,写了一篇如何装 Linux 和 Windows 10 双系统的文章发在了简书上,我写这篇文章的原因是当初装双系统确实是折腾了许久,网上也找不到一篇详尽的教程.由于去年对于写教程还 ...

  7. linux磁盘信息文件,Linux查看硬盘信息方法总结归纳

    Linux查看硬盘信息方法总结归纳 lsblk lsblk命令用来查看接入到系统中的块设备,默认输出分区.大小.挂载点等信息,一目了然: tlanyan@node1:~$ lsblk sda 8:0 ...

  8. Linux fs清理文件,linux – 在fs崩溃并运行fsck之后,一些文件被恢复但是找不到丢失的文件?...

    我在外部硬盘驱动器分区sdb4上有一个I / O错误(它通常的挂载点是/ run / media / yan / data). 分区没有响应,无法访问并拒绝卸载.我不知道该怎么办但拔下磁盘并重新插上它 ...

  9. linux密码加密文件,Linux下加密/解密及用密码保护文件的七把利器

    加密是指对文件进行编码的过程,那样只有有权访问的人才可以访问文件.人类早在计算机还没有问世的时候就开始使用加密了.战争期间,人类会传输只有其部落或相关人员才能理解的某种信息. 作者:布加迪/编译来源: ...

最新文章

  1. windows server 2008 R2 初试Hyper-V(一)
  2. Android初学第29天
  3. petalinux zynq spi_ZYNQ 系列 01 | PL 实现按键控制 LED(1)
  4. 写给小白看的硬核递归(低调点,当回小白)
  5. AI in RTC 创新挑战赛,决赛打响
  6. 【学习笔记】opencv的python接口 几何变换
  7. 排序算法——(1)简介
  8. Linux网络深入DHCP、FTP原理和配置方法(详细图解)
  9. 图解cacti简单使用
  10. 双指针法(leetcode分类解题,C++代码详细注释)
  11. internetreadfile读取数据长度为0_YOLOV3的TensorFlow2.0实现,支持在自己的数据集上训练...
  12. 鸿蒙系统的变化,鸿蒙系统没变化的背后
  13. activemq linux教程,Linux及Windows下ActiveMQ下载与安装教程
  14. aspnet还有人用吗_微信公众号软件安装管家会员真的那么好吗
  15. SAP 是不是很烂的一个ERP软件
  16. C语言随机读写数据文件(一)
  17. Gartner 如何看 RASP 和 WAF?
  18. 下载代码的两种方式ssh 和 https
  19. 专利挖掘和撰写(京东技术资质申请和创造专利挖掘)
  20. 圆柱体积怎么算立方公式_圆柱体积计算公式 计算方法及例题

热门文章

  1. 熊谢刚:AI和5G让容联·云通讯弯道超车
  2. FFmpeg优化 苏宁PP体育视频剪切效率提升技巧
  3. ACL 2019 | 图表示解决长文本关系匹配问题:腾讯提出概念交互图算法
  4. TDSQL 全时态数据库系统-理念与愿景
  5. error: RPC failed; curl 56 GnuTLS recv error (-54): Error in the pull function.
  6. Redis的 key 和 value大小限制
  7. YOLO (You only look once) 实时目标检测
  8. redis-cli 命令详解
  9. go context的使用总结
  10. Spark对Kafka两种连接方式的对比——Receiver和Direct